NAAS at Durban FilmMart 2025

A NAAS delegation participated at the Durban FilmMart 2025 by taking part at a panel and presenting the network at the market.

NAAS’ 2025 Delegation was consisting of:

Hanna Atallah - Film Lab Palestine (Palestine)

Mohamed Jabaly - Palestine Film Institute (Palestine)

Brahim Snoopy - Sudan Film Factory (Sudan)

Reem Magued - Cimatheque - Alternative Film Center (Egypt)

Nada Bakr and Mai El-Gammal - Network of Arab Alternative Screens (Germany)


Group picture with the delegation at the booth © Durban FilmMart

The objectives of our attendance were the following:

  • Showcase the members of the delegation representing the network, highlighting their diverse projects, creative visions, and potential for international collaboration.

  • Promote the Work of the Network - Introduce the mission, ongoing programs, and strategic objectives of the network to industry stakeholders, funders, and potential partners attending the Durban FilmMart.

  • Showcase Individual Delegates’ Projects - Each delegate will be responsible for presenting their own film or project through personalized printed materials and video content.

  • Increase Visibility and Build Industry Relationships - Leverage the presence at DFM to strengthen connections with African and international producers, distributors, festival programmers, and market representatives.

Panel talk: Working Together as NAAS

In a region marked by cultural richness and system precarity, collaboration across borders is both a challenge and a necessity. This panel brings together key members of NAAS (Network of Arab Alternative Screens) to reflect on how shared purpose and collective action have enabled us to grow as a network committed to diversifying film access, reimagining exhibition practices, and encouraging critical film cultures across the Arab region.

Through the experiences of four NAAS members (Sudan Film Factory, Film Lab Palestine, Palestine Film Institute, and Cimatheque Cairo) this conversation unpacks how we work together despite different local realities, how we build joint programs and how NAAS practices solidarity and sustainability through regionally grounded models. Nada Bakr, the Executive Director did the moderation.
